Data Vault

The Data Vault Service listens for data being sent from Clients, processes the data, and stores it in the Data Vault folders. You will manage the Data Vault Service from the Control Center.

Data Vault Service Tasks

The recorded data follows this sequence of events.

To store data:

  1. The Client records events, storing the data temporarily on the Client computer hard drive.

  2. Once every four minutes, the Client attempts to deliver the data across the network through the established port.

  1. The Data Vault service listens on the established port and responds to the Client communication.  

  2. When the recorded events are received by the Data Vault service,  the Client deletes them from the local client hard drive.

  3. The Data Vault Service receives the data and stores it in a user or computer folder on the Data Vault computer.

Accessing and Managing the Data

Once the data is in the Data Vault, a user can open the Viewer (from the Control Center or as a standalone application), navigate to the Data Vault folders, and select one to load and view the data.  A user with appropriate privileges can save and delete data, and the Control Center provides several automatic archiving options.

Network Requirements

The Data Vault service must be installed on a network computer that all Clients will be able to communicate with at any time. Servers are rarely turned off or removed from the network so this reason, a server is an excellent candidate on which to install the Data Vault.

Using Multiple Data Vaults

In larger installations, for example, 200+ Clients, it may become necessary to install multiple instances of the Data Vault MSDEto allow the Data Vault service to handle the volume of traffic being recorded. For each Data Vault, you need to install a Control Center to manage it, not necessarily on the same computer. See the Spector CNE Deployment Guide.

Computers with installed Clients will need to be configured to communicate with the specific computer where the Data Vault Service is installed.
